Razor's Elemental Burst makes him more resistant to interruption, plus it imbues his attacks with Electro. A good strategy would be to use Barbara's Elemental Skill and have Thrilling Tales of Dragon Slayers equipped on her, then to swap out to Razor and use his Elemental Burst. You'd give Razor an attack boost thanks to Thrilling Tales of Dragon Slayers, and would be able to create Electro-Charged reactions with Barbara's Elemental Skill surrounding Ra

The Favonius Lance has the unique ability to give you a better base attack at 44, combined with an energy restoration skill. The skill gives critical hits a 60-100 percent chance at regenerating elemental particles, in turn giving you more energy to put towards your elemental burst.
